As a person who played live 14 for days worth of actual gameplay time the difficulty has a huge impact on the game. The difference between rookie and superstar is m more drastic than night and day. B because of a lack of sliders the difficulties change more than a regular difficulty toggle.
When I first played live 14 it was on pro and I thought the game was literally brain dead. There was no activity, players were stupid and when you went to the rack collisions didn't seem right, balls going thru hands, unrealistic passes were everywhere. Superstar put a stop to most of that. Collisions became more realistic, passes that were improbable got intercepted is tipped and there were much more collisions in the paint. The game felt much more authentic. Definitely playable and pretty enjoyable.
So take that Gamestop video with a grain of salt because I'm sure he was playing the game on pro or rookie. Which is common for showcases because developers think people want to see cool dunks.
